Ben Stoeger BSPS BOSS DOH Dropped Offset Holster Hanger Mount System 

This hanger is adjustable yet stable. It will hold your holster in the position of your choosing allowing for a safe and secure draw. This holster hanger can be mounted ambidextrously making it appropriate for left and right handed shooters.

The holster can be mounted higher up, making it Single Stack legal if you desire.

This is just the holster hanger. Supply your own pouch. This is compatible with Blade Tech, GX Holster, LS Holsters, Weber Tactical and Comp Tac stuff.

What are the differences in the Belt Mount Options?

We offer a few options for belt mounts on the Boss holster. The standard aluminum belt plate will come with all of the holsters regardless if you choose one of the options mounts. Something to consider if you go with a non-standard belt mount you may want to go with a shorter Offset Spacer like the 1/4" to stay withing the USPSA rules.

boss-standard-medium.png

The Boss Standard Belt Mount is included with all orders.

This belt plate is cut for a standard 1.5" competition belt (DAA, CR Speed, Ghost).

The spacing between the screws will accommodate a 1.75" belt.

boss-tek-lok-medium.png

The Blade-Tech Tek-Lok Belt Mount is a great Quick Detach option.

These mounts are adjustable and can accommodate 1.25"-2" belts

We generally recommend going with the 1/4" offset spacer option with this mount.

boss-plm-medium.png

The Comp-Tac PLM Belt Mount is a great Quick Detach option.

These mounts are adjustable and can accommodate 1.25"-2" belts

We generally recommend going with the 1/4" offset spacer option with this mount

boss-qls-medium.png

The Safariland QLS Belt Mount work with the QLS Receiver.

You can quickly swap holsters when using the Safariland QLS system. This option includes the fork only.

We generally recommend going with the 1/4" offset spacer option with this mount

 


Which Offset length should I choose?

This refers to the length of the spacers between the long Boss plate and the Y-Plate that attaches to the holster. The 1/2" spacers are a pretty safe bet for most firearms out there to keep you within the rules for USPSA. 

If you go with one of the options mounts (Tek-Lok, PLM, ELS) we would recommend choosing the 1/2" spacers to keep your holster within the rules for USPSA.

We have seen the 3/4" work well for most models, and may work with Tek-Lok & PLM mounts. 

We have found the 1" spacers to work with most models but you should measure your setup to insure it falls within the USPSA rules.

Instructions


boss-diagram.png

 

1. Attach Y-plate to holster body through three large holes on the Y-plate using supplied short round-head screws to the backers included with your holster.

2. Attach Y-plate to slotted hanger plate using supplied long screws and spacers (do not install lock washers yet). Screw heads should be on the rounded side of the hanger plate, one screw in a center hole and the other in the corresponding curved slot.

3. Hold belt inside belt plate cutout and install onto main hangar plate with 4 flat-head screws, solidly mounting holster and hanger to belt.

4. Test location of holster with unloaded firearm. Adjust to preferred height and tilt by changing screw positions on the main hangar plate and Y-plate. Verify position meets rule requirements

5. Mark position of long screws lightly with a pencil and then remove and re-install the long screws with a lock washer underneath the screw heads. Apply threadlocker to all screws.  

* Verify firearm position meets appropriate rule requirements
